Clifton Mining Co Business Description

Address 705 East 50 South, American Fork, UT, USA, 84003
Clifton Mining Co is mainly engaged in mining property management by joint venturing the properties to other companies, including the use of the company's equipment to bring the claims into production and investing in other businesses. It generates revenue by leasing its patented mining claims and milling equipment to third parties, either through direct leasing fees or joint venture relationships, and by receiving net smelter royalty payments. The Company also owns two mill buildings located in Gold Hill, Utah, along with some milling and mining equipment located in those buildings.
